Sådan sammenlignes to filer for ændringer ved hjælp af kommandoprompt

Hvis du søger efter en måde at sammenligne to filer på Windows 10/11 uden noget tredjepartsprogram, har vi en måde for dig. I denne vejledning viser vi dig, hvordan du kan sammenligne to filer for ændringer med kommandoprompt(compare two files for changes with Command Prompt) på Windows 10/11.

Du kan sammenligne to filer ved hjælp af kommandoerne fc.exe(fc.exe) og comp.exe -filsammenligning . Du kan bruge fc.exe til at sammenligne to ASCII- eller binære filer på linje-for-linje-basis. windiff.exe -værktøjet, et værktøj, der grafisk sammenligner indholdet af to ASCII - filer eller indholdet af to mapper, der indeholder ASCII - filer, for at kontrollere, om de er ens.

Sådan sammenlignes to filer for ændringer ved hjælp af kommandoprompt på Windows 11/10

Hvis du vil finde ud af, hvordan to lignende filer har undergået ændringer over tid, er der en indbygget kommando på Windows , som lader dig sammenligne. Den kommando er fc. Denne kommando er nyttig til at sammenligne to tekstfiler og ved, hvordan de ændres i dets script og dets ændringer. Med kommandoen ' fc ' kan du sammenligne en tekstfil med dens seneste version eller finde ændringer på scriptniveau i forskellige scripts som Binary , Unicode eller ASCII . Lad os se, hvordan vi kan bruge 'fc'-kommandoen og sammenligne to filer(Files) for ændringer med kommandoprompt(Command Prompt)Windows 10/11 .

Sammenlign to (Compare two) filer(Files) for ændringer(Changes) ved hjælp af FC.exe -kommandolinjen

Der er forskellige parametre i fc- kommandoen, som du kan bruge den til at opnå forskellige resultater efter at have indtastet syntaksen i kommandoprompt(Command Prompt) .

Parametre(Parameters)

Betyder(Meaning)

Sammenligner de to filer i binær tilstand, byte for byte, og forsøger ikke at gensynkronisere filerne efter at have fundet en uoverensstemmelse. 

Ignorerer store og små bogstaver.

Sammenligner filerne i ASCII -tilstand, linje for linje, og forsøger at gensynkronisere filerne efter at have fundet en uoverensstemmelse.

/lb<n>

Indstiller antallet af linjer for den interne linjebuffer til  N . Standardlængden af ​​linjebufferen er 100 linjer. Hvis de filer, du sammenligner, har mere end 100 på hinanden følgende forskellige linjer,   annullerer fc sammenligningen.(fc)

Viser linjenumrene under en ASCII - sammenligning.

Forhindrer  fc  i at konvertere faner til mellemrum.

Sammenligner filer som Unicode- tekstfiler.

Komprimerer(Compresses) mellemrum (det vil sige tabulatorer og mellemrum) under sammenligningen. Hvis en linje indeholder mange på hinanden følgende mellemrum eller tabulatorer,  behandler /w  disse tegn som et enkelt mellemrum. Når det bruges med  /w ,  ignorerer fc  hvidt mellemrum i begyndelsen og slutningen af ​​en linje.



About the author

Jeg er en computersikkerhedsekspert med over 10 års erfaring med speciale i Windows-apps og -filer. Jeg har skrevet og/eller gennemgået hundredvis af artikler om forskellige emner relateret til computersikkerhed, der hjælper enkeltpersoner med at forblive sikre online. Jeg er også en erfaren konsulent for virksomheder, der har brug for hjælp til at beskytte deres systemer mod databrud eller cyberangreb.



Related posts